How much do electrical and computer engineer jobs pay per year?

As of Jul 14, 2026, the average yearly pay for electrical and computer engineer in Indiana is $105,710.00, according to ZipRecruiter salary data. Most workers in this role earn between $79,000.00 and $125,600.00 per year, depending on experience, location, and employer.

What is the difference between Electrical And Computer Engineer vs Electrical Engineer?

AspectElectrical And Computer EngineerElectrical Engineer
CredentialsBachelor's in Electrical Engineering or Computer Engineering; optional certifications like PE or CiscoBachelor's in Electrical Engineering; similar certifications
Work EnvironmentDesigning embedded systems, computer hardware, software integrationPower systems, circuit design, electrical equipment
Industry UsageTechnology, computing, telecommunications, embedded systemsPower generation, manufacturing, utilities, electronics

Electrical And Computer Engineers focus on integrating electrical systems with computing and software, often working on embedded systems and hardware-software interfaces. Electrical Engineers primarily work on power systems, circuitry, and electrical equipment. Both roles require similar credentials but differ in their core focus and industry applications.

What are electrical and computer engineers?

Electrical and computer engineers are professionals who design, develop, test, and maintain electrical systems, devices, and computer hardware and software. They work on a wide range of technologies, from power generation and transmission to embedded systems, robotics, communications, and computing platforms. Their expertise spans both the hardware (electrical circuits, devices) and the software (algorithms, programming) that drive modern technology. Electrical and computer engineers are essential in industries like telecommunications, energy, aerospace, and consumer electronics.

What are the key skills and qualifications needed to thrive as an Electrical and Computer Engineer, and why are they important?

To thrive as an Electrical and Computer Engineer, you need a solid background in circuit design, embedded systems, programming, and a relevant engineering degree such as a BS or MS in Electrical or Computer Engineering. Familiarity with tools like MATLAB, CAD software (e.g., Altium Designer, AutoCAD), and programming languages such as C/C++ or Python, as well as certifications like FE or PE, are often required. Critical thinking, problem-solving, teamwork, and effective communication help engineers excel in collaborative and innovative environments. These skills and qualifications are essential for developing reliable, cutting-edge technology solutions and ensuring project success in a competitive industry.

TSC is seeking an Electrical Engineer based in Bloomington, IN. The Electrical Engineer will provide engineering support to ongoing efforts at Naval Surface Warfare Center (NSWC) Crane. The engineer will apply expert-level hardware engineering skills to dissect complex naval systems, identify and document component-level details, and develop repeatable processes to support sustainment, modernization, and lifecycle management activities. Headquartered in Arlington, Virginia, Technology Service Corporation (TSC) is an employee-owned company that has been providing high-quality technical services and solutions for our customers' for over 50 years. Our diverse portfolio includes providing full lifecycle support in Precision Strike and Area Effects; Area Protection; Airborne Sensors and Intelligence, Surveillance, and Reconnaissance (ISR); Vehicle Protection; Electronic Warfare Systems; Air and Missile Defense; Space Systems, and Intelligence and Information Systems. Responsibilities: This position requires a flexible individual with experience in Electrical Engineering at a variety of levels. Depending on their expertise, this person's responsibilities would include some or all of the following: * Identify, remove, and categorize internal hardware components and subassemblies.
* Analyze system architecture, interconnects, signal paths, and functional hardware blocks.
* Develop comprehensive Bill of Materials (BOM) and parts lists for each system.
* Document hardware configurations, component specifications, cabling, connectors, and assemblies.
* Produce engineering documentation that aligns with NSWC Crane standards and Navy technical requirements
* Design and write detailed hardware test procedures for system evaluation, functional testing, and component verification.
* Collaborate with test engineers and technicians to validate procedures.
* Support creation of acceptance test plans, diagnostic processes, and troubleshooting workflows.
* Provide hardware-focused engineering recommendations for repair, modification, or lifecycle support.
* Support failure analysis activities and assist in root-cause investigations.
* Participate in technical meetings, design reviews, and program discussions with government stakeholders.
Required Qualifications: * Bachelor's degree in Electrical Engineering, Electronics Engineering, Computer Engineering, or related engineering discipline with 0-2 years with internship/co-op experience in a related field or a Master's degree.
* Ability to obtain and maintain a Secret DoD Clearance Preferred Qualifications: * Knowledge of electrical circuits and reading schematics
* Skilled in diagnosing and repairing power electronics systems
* Development and validation of troubleshooting and repair procedures
* Conducting hazard analysis for high-voltage work environments
* Experience with silicone and epoxy-based high-voltage encapsulation materials
Key Competencies * Strong hands-on, hardware-first engineering mindset.
* Excellent technical writing and documentation skills.
* Analytical problem-solving abilities.
* Ability to work independently and in cross-functional teams.
* Attention to detail and accuracy in engineering documentation.
